Foundation Slab Construction in Greenville, SC
Foundation slab construction involves creating a solid, level concrete base that supports the structure of a building or home. This service is essential for new construction projects, including residential homes, garages, or additions, as well as for foundation repairs or modifications to existing structures. Property owners typically seek this service to ensure a stable and durable foundation, which is crucial for the longevity and safety of the property. Before requesting foundation slab construction, it’s important to understand site conditions, soil stability, and any necessary permits or inspections that may be required for the project.
The process generally includes site preparation, excavation, and pouring a reinforced concrete slab designed to meet the specific needs of the property. Homeowners often want to know about the materials used, the expected lifespan of the foundation, and how the construction will impact their property during the project. Clear communication about the scope of work, timeline, and any potential disruptions can help property owners make informed decisions and prepare accordingly for a successful foundation slab installation.

Foundation Slab Construction Questions
What is a foundation slab? A foundation slab is a flat concrete surface that provides a stable base for a building’s structure, often used in residential and commercial projects in Greenville.
When is a concrete slab necessary? A concrete slab is typically used when building on level ground or when a solid, durable foundation is needed for a home or addition.
What factors influence the durability of a foundation slab? Soil conditions, proper drainage, and quality of materials all play a role in the longevity of a concrete slab foundation.
Can a foundation slab be customized for specific projects? Yes, slabs can be designed to accommodate different sizes, load requirements, and finishing preferences for various property types.
